ponding
English
Noun
ponding (usually uncountable, plural pondings)
- (construction, geology) The excessive accumulation of water at low-lying areas that remains after 48 hours after the end of rainfall under conditions conducive to drying.
- The accumulation of water on a flat roof, potentially leading to leakage.

Noun
flooding (plural floodings)
- An act of flooding; a flood or gush.
- 1875, Mark Twain, Some Learned Fables for Good Old Boys and Girls
- And by the same token it was plain that there had also been a hundred and seventy-five floodings of the earth and depositings of limestone strata!
- 1875, Mark Twain, Some Learned Fables for Good Old Boys and Girls
- (psychology, figuratively) Emotional overwhelm sometimes leading to a primal state of rage or panic.
